回答:API:应用程序接口(API:Application Program Interface)应用程序接口(API:application programming interface)是一组定义、程序及协议的集合,通过 API接口实现计算机软件之间的相互通信。API 的一个主要功能是提供通用功能集。程序员通过使用 API函数开发应用程序,从而可以避免编写无用程序,以减轻编程任务。 API 同时也是一种...
回答:我们知道API其实就是应用程序编程接口,可以把它理解为是一种通道,用来和不同软件系统间进行通信,本质上它是预先定义的函数。API有很多种形式,最为常见的就是以HTTP协议来提供服务(如:RESTful),只要符合规范就可正常使用。现在各类企业在信息化这块都会用到第三方提供的API,也会提供API给第三方调用,因此设计API也是需要慎重的。具体该如何开发设计一个良好的API接口呢?明确功能在设计之初...
回答:具体得视情况而定。如果接口进行的是读操作,是不需要校验数据库的。如果接口进行的是写操作,严谨的说是需要的,并且涉及的字段均需要校验。读操作接口进行读数据库操作,如GET方式,即查询,验证期望响应内容与实际响应内容,即验证了数据入库-数据查询流程,因此不需要校验数据库。当然,每次执行自动化是需要进行环境初始化,每次运行自动化用例前插入自动化测试数据,运行结束后清空自动化数据。写操作接口进行写数据库操...
...几个领域模型:VO、BO、DO、DTO。其中,DO(Data Object)与数据库表结构一一对应,通过 DAO 层向上传输数据源对象。 而 DTO(Data Transfer Object)是远程调用对象,它是 RPC 服务提供的领域模型。对于 BO(Business Object),它是业务逻辑...
...几个领域模型:VO、BO、DO、DTO。其中,DO(Data Object)与数据库表结构一一对应,通过 DAO 层向上传输数据源对象。 而 DTO(Data Transfer Object)是远程调用对象,它是 RPC 服务提供的领域模型。对于 BO(Business Object),它是业务逻辑...
...和后端工程师得以并行工作。当遇到前端界面展示需要的数据,而后端对应的接口还没有完成开发的情况时,需要一个数据源来保证前端工作的顺利进行。 今天这篇文章,我们会介绍几种常见的方法和其中存在的问题,并提出...
...者工具控制台提示 可以发现控制台并没有输出任何返回数据, 因为它也没有数据可输出, 而是给出了下面这样一个提示信息: 浏览器开发者工具网络请求列表详情 而在网络请求列表可以看到请求资源URL没有返回任何数据 后端...
... post /api/user 删除用户信息 delete /api/user/1 区别 相同:数据一般以json或xml格式返回 不同: Restful API:操作的是资源;增删改查对应http动词 传统API : 只有get/post动词; HTTP状态码 注意:API接口返回的 JSON数据 中包含的是业...
...的改变进行容错. 也就是说, 消费者获取到提供者返回的数据时, 无论这个数据如何变化, 我们只需要从中获取到我们想要的数据, 可以忽略新的消息项、可选的消息项等不需要的数据. 只有当消费者不能完全识别接收到的消息, 或...
...对应entry的version节点值; jdbc.properties: 这个都懂的,存放数据库连接信息; configure.xml: root下的子节点可以随便写,但不能包含属性。在服务器运行过程中,一旦此文件内容发生了变化,会实时生效,无需重启。 举例,从下面...
... field 如果在 GraphQL Server 中有对应的 resolver,那么在返回数据时候,这些 field 就由对应的 resolver 的执行结果填充(支持返回 promise)。 客户端请求 这里借助 graphiql 面板的功能来发送请求: 看一下 http request payload 信息: 响应体...
...od 和路由 正确的使用 HTTP 状态码 使用 HTTP Header 来发送元数据 为 REST API 挑选合适的框架 要对 API 进行黑盒测试 使用基于 JWT 的无状态的认证机制 学会使用条件请求机制 拥抱接口调用频率限制(Rate-Limiting) 编写良好的 API 文档 ...
...册登陆模块,需求分析如下: 注册成为新用户,对输入的数据进行校验 登陆进入系统,需要对输入的数据进行校验,基于token鉴权认证 登出功能 登陆进去可以在用户中心模块查看个人信息 在用户中心模块修改个人信息 数据分...
...册登陆模块,需求分析如下: 注册成为新用户,对输入的数据进行校验 登陆进入系统,需要对输入的数据进行校验,基于token鉴权认证 登出功能 登陆进去可以在用户中心模块查看个人信息 在用户中心模块修改个人信息 数据分...
...8年JavaScript生态圈趋势报告》一文中,我们看到了2018年在数据层GraphQL的发展势头猛烈,并且大部分用户用过都说好,但如上图数据显示,目前国内的使用人数还很少,大部分人连听都没听过,今天小肆就为大家介绍一下,何为Gr...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...